WebSatari: A Swedish variant on the monitor roof; a double hip roof with a short vertical wall usually with small windows, popular from the 17th century on formal buildings. [citation needed] (Säteritak in Swedish.) Mansard (French roof): A roof with the pitch divided into a shallow slope above a steeper slope. The steep slope may be curved. WebOverview. Although uncommon, there are situations where architectural parameters require “off angle” hip and valley roof construction. The most common parameter is to maintain an equal ridge height over building sections with differing spans. To maintain a consistent ridge height in these situations the roof pitch must be adjusted. A roof … bremsecaliper vw caddyWebFeb 18, 2024 · Cover the sheathing in a layer of felt paper. Use 30 lb (14 kg) felt paper to help protect the wood from condensation. Lay the paper flat across the roof’s surface and pound in a construction nail every 24 in (61 cm).
